Chaura Population - Rewa, Madhya Pradesh
Chaura is a large village located in Teonthar Tehsil of Rewa district, Madhya Pradesh with total 455 families residing. The Chaura village has population of 2004 of which 1070 are males while 934 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Chaura village population of children with age 0-6 is 363 which makes up 18.11 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chaura village is 873 which is lower than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Chaura as per census is 995, higher than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Chaura village has higher liter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Chaura village was 71.36 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Chaura Male literacy stands at 81.31 % while female literacy rate was 59.63 %.

Chaura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 455 | - | - |
Population | 2,004 | 1,070 | 934 |
Child (0-6) | 363 | 182 | 181 |
Schedule Caste | 338 | 183 | 155 |
Schedule Tribe | 143 | 73 | 70 |
Literacy | 71.36 % | 81.31 % | 59.63 % |
Total Workers | 792 | 547 | 245 |
Main Worker | 587 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 205 | 6 | 199 |
